Mission

 

Perea Elementary School will prepare all students academically, socially, and emotionally for success by creating and maintaining a classroom and school environment that is student-centered, with high academic expectations and where all students feel welcomed, appreciated, and valued.

 

Core Values

  • Empathy: to lovingly respond
  • Community: to create fellowship
  • Excellence: to consistently give your BEST
  • Innovation: creative thinking & learning
  • Safety: ALL are protected

Academic Committee

Dr. Ingram gave the Academics Committee update. He shared that PPS is in 60-90 day window for approval to move into phase two of NAEYC accreditation process. We will have 30 days to respond to any corrections presented.

Governance Committee

C. Carter made a motion to apply to amend our charter to add seats to accommodate our previously approved grade expansion.
B. Ingram seconded the motion.
The board VOTED unanimously to approve the motion.

Dr. Scott presented two candidates for board approval. Both are parents of Perea students: Wendolyn Cade and Andrea Fenise. 

R. Scott made a motion to add Wendolyn Cade as a board member and parent representative.
D. Moses seconded the motion.
The board VOTED unanimously to approve the motion.
R. Scott made a motion to add Andrea Fenise as a board member and parent representative.
B. Ingram seconded the motion.
The board VOTED unanimously to approve the motion.

Dr. Scott reminded board members that all board training is due by June 30, 2026.

Dr. Davis's evaluation is on track for completion. Board members are asked to complete the evaluations by June 15, 2026. Summary results will be shared with the full board and an evaluation memo will be shared with Dr. Davis in July. 

Suggested date for the board retreat is August 29, 2026, 8 am - 1 pm. 

The committee is currently reviewing bonus pay structure for senior leadership.

Dr. Scott provided board meeting dates for SY26-27.
